Established Year: 2017
Franchise Units: As of 2024, Chick N Max operates 7 locations, with plans for rapid expansion.
Founders: Max Sheets, an industry veteran with over three decades of experience in the restaurant sector, founded Chick N Max.
Company History: Max Sheets, after extensive experience with brands like Smashburger and Ted’s Montana Grill, conceptualized Chick N Max to offer a healthier alternative in the chicken segment. The first restaurant opened in January 2018, and franchising began in 2021.
Ownership & Market Presence: Chick N Max is privately owned and has established a presence in Kansas, South Dakota, and Texas, with plans to expand into other key U.S. markets.
Industry Category: Fast Casual Dining – Chicken Segment

Financial Item | Amount / Range | Notes / Details |
---|---|---|
Initial Franchise Fee | $35,000 | One-time fee paid to the franchisor. |
Total Investment Required | $650,000 – $2,500,000 | Includes build-out, equipment, furniture, initial inventory, and working capital. |
Minimum Cash Requirement | $600,000 | Liquid capital needed to open and sustain initial operations. |
Royalty Fee | 4.5% of gross sales | Paid monthly for ongoing support and brand usage. |
Marketing / Advertising Fee | Variable / Co-op participation | Franchisees participate in local and national marketing campaigns. |
Net Worth Requirement | $2,500,000 | Total personal assets required to qualify as a franchisee. |
Infrastructure / Build-Out Cost | $400,000 – $1,500,000 | Includes leasehold improvements, kitchen equipment, signage, and décor. |
Working Capital | $50,000 – $100,000 | Covers staff wages, initial inventory, and operational expenses before break-even. |
